Find the slope, if it exists. \( x=-6 \) Select the correct choice below and fill in any answer boxes within your choice. A. The slope of the line is \( \mathrm{m}=\square \). (Type an integer or a simplified fraction.) B. The slope is undefined.

The equation \( x = -6 \) represents a vertical line.
1. **Understanding the slope of a vertical line:**
- The slope of a line is defined as the change in \( y \) divided by the change in \( x \) (i.e., \( m = \frac{\Delta y}{\Delta x} \)).
- For a vertical line, the change in \( x \) is always zero (since \( x \) does not change), which leads to division by zero in the slope formula.
2. **Conclusion:**
- Since division by zero is undefined, the slope of a vertical line is also undefined.
Thus, the correct choice is:
B. The slope is undefined.
